Exam blueprint
Now fully digital in 2026. 80 MCQ + 6 FRQ. 250 required works.
Unit 1Global Prehistory (30,000–500 BCE)4%
Unit 2Ancient Mediterranean (3500 BCE–300 CE)15%
Unit 3Early Europe and Colonial Americas (200–1750)21%
Unit 4Later Europe and Americas (1750–1980)21%
Unit 5Indigenous Americas6%
Unit 6Africa (1100–1980)6%
Unit 7West and Central Asia4%
Unit 8South, East, and Southeast Asia8%
Unit 9The Pacific4%
Unit 10Global Contemporary (1980–present)11%
Source: College Board Course & Exam Descriptions, 2025–26.
